Chapter 67 Alfred & 1 day's plan is in the morning
The weather in Gotham is always gloomy and headaches, Alfred thought when he pushed open the heavy old wooden door again and walked into the cold and empty kitchen as always.
He opened the cupboard and pressed his kneecaps with his hanging fingers, trying to let the broken bones rest for a while, so that he could make a good breakfast—or lunch—for his young master.But what was irritating was that the pain protruding densely from the bone crevices seemed to increase instead of decrease, and rushed up his spine like a clamor, and spread into his head.Alfred kept his usual politeness in silence, not allowing himself to jump up from the ground like a child - of course, for him now, that might be a bit beyond his ability.
He put down the clean plate and the shiny fork as gracefully as possible, moved his legs that were no longer useful, slowly and gently climbed the overly long stairs, and stood quietly in front of a door and listened A few minutes - most of it was spent making sure his old ears were still working.
Alfred stared at the continuous grain of wood on the door until they dutifully sank into the other end, before pulling his attention away from the person inside.
Oh, of course.I'm not worried about my young master, Alfred told himself, it's just that my little young master doesn't have enough self-control to let him rest on the bed.He laughed silently for two seconds at the thought, and suddenly felt another—wonderful and terrible feeling rushing through his heart: How wonderful that I stand at the door of my master's son, ready to do all the work for him .
In Alfred's plan, he was supposed to get a new day's newspaper and mail, but now he changed his mind. He stood outside the room, thinking about the new one on his master's back. A fresh 5-inch wound, and suddenly worried that the young master will kick the quilt-oh come on, old man.He'll remember that, or he'll have to suffer from a cold.But is his trained body not as good as mine?He thought, silently resisting the urge to open the door, cover the person on the bed who was immersed in a dream—maybe it would not be good—and check the wound by the way.
You can't stay with him forever.he thought, resolving to go downstairs and serve the dishes.But—when he glanced at the door that seemed to exude an ancient atmosphere, he immediately decided to go to the Batcave again.Maybe he'll find something to do there—maybe it's time to get a new batch of batdarangs?
Alfred didn't hesitate any longer - come on, he's not that old yet.But when he thought of the word "old", he felt cringe for the first time.
He faltered, suddenly considering whether to buy a cane as those fragile, nervous kneecaps screamed at him again.
Alfred poured out the cold coffee on the table, slowly rinsed the cup under cold water, and put it on the motionless black tray reasonably and properly—what should I say?He remembered that the white one was originally placed here.He scanned the ominous color, muttering to himself about his master's little eccentricity—he wasn't afraid that one day he would come home and find that the house had turned black.
Alfred gave a rare sigh, deliberately ignoring the fact that it took him five minutes to find a nearby cup.look at you.He said that he suddenly found that the chair that usually pleases the owner the most—it was black again—spotted bright red.
He walked over slowly, praying that there was no blood from a dog bite.
— Unexpectedly, it was not.Alfred raised his eyebrows, carried the piece of red fabric, and found the half "S" left on it as expected.
Friendship—he sighed, looking at the tattered cloak with mixed and amazed eyes.Then he tried to put it back as if nothing had changed, hoping it would put someone in a better mood who had been working through exhaustion.
After doing all this, Alfred glanced around cautiously as usual to make sure that nothing was left behind.
He tidied up his bat outfit, swept away all the dust, cleaned the coffee cup, counted the bat darts, filled out the purchase order for various consumable raw materials, replaced a batch of equipment, checked the monitoring and security system, and took the time to Checked to see if there was a bat projection outside the window - he had completed all the tasks.
Oh yes, and his cane.Alfred silently added the cane item to the purchase list in his mind, and raised his eyes to scan the Batcave again.
I did it just in case.He said to himself, quietly closed the door hidden behind many traps, and protested with his legs, went upstairs and inspected it again.
very good.he thinks.Staring at the minutes on the watch, expecting the latter to move a tick.
Taking a deep breath of air, he slammed open the door, and after putting on a suitable smile, he walked to the tall French windows neatly and quickly, and pulled open the curtains that blocked the sun without muddling—
"Hey, Alfred, it's only nine o'clock!"
"Oh, master. The day's plan is in the morning, even if you are a nocturnal creature, you can't change it." Alfred said to Bruce, who was trying in vain to suffocate himself with pillows on the bed, and reminded him empathetically: " Besides, you chose to go out and party at night."
"Oh come on, Alfred."
